Frequently Asked Questions
1. What is OCR?
OCR stands for Optical Character Recognition and converts text visible in images into machine-readable text.
2. Can OCR convert scanned PDFs into editable text?
Yes, OCR can recognise printed text in scanned PDFs and produce selectable text.
3. Can OCR process multi-page PDFs?
Yes, pages can be rendered and processed individually.
4. Can OCR recognise Hindi?
Yes, when an appropriate Hindi language model is available.
5. Can OCR recognise Bengali?
Yes, with the appropriate Bengali language model.
6. Can OCR recognise handwriting?
Traditional Tesseract-based OCR is primarily designed for printed text and may perform poorly with handwriting.
7. Why does OCR produce incorrect words?
Poor image quality, unusual fonts, skew, noise, and complex layouts can reduce accuracy.
8. How can OCR accuracy be improved?
Use high-resolution scans, correct the page orientation, improve contrast, remove noise, and select the correct language.
9. Can OCR recognise tables?
It can recognise text inside tables, but preserving complex table structure may require specialised document-layout processing.
10. Can OCR create searchable PDFs?
Yes. OCR systems can create PDFs containing a searchable text layer.
11. Can I download OCR results?
A properly designed tool can provide TXT and other export formats.
12. Does OCR work offline?
Browser-based OCR can be designed to process documents locally, depending on the libraries and implementation.
13. Is OCR 100% accurate?
No. Always verify important extracted information against the original document.
14. What is the best PDF for OCR?
A high-resolution, straight, clear scan with strong contrast generally provides better results.
15. Can OCR extract text from engineering drawings?
It can recognise printed text, but it may not interpret dimensions, symbols, CAD geometry, or complex technical notation correctly.
